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Broken Ridge Skate | Noctule |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Elasmobranchii |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Rajiformes (Rajiformes) | Chiroptera (Bats) |
| Family | Arhynchobatidae | Vespertilionidae |
| Genus | Notoraja | Nyctalus |
| Species | Notoraja lira | Nyctalus noctula |
Evolutionary Relationship
Broken Ridge Skate and Noctule share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
